The Real Cost of Downtime: How Preventive Maintenance Saves Your Fleet Thousands

Every minute one of your trucks is sidelined, your business is losing money. And it's not just about the repair invoice. There's the missed delivery deadline, the cost of rerouting jobs, idle employees, penalties from clients, and even potential damage to your company’s reputation. Add the cost of emergency vehicle rentals, and it becomes clear that downtime is expensive.

That’s why preventive maintenance isn’t a luxury. It’s a strategy. At KTS Diesel, we’ve worked with fleets that have cut their emergency repairs by nearly half just by sticking to a regular maintenance schedule. Simple actions like changing oil on time, monitoring fluid levels, rotating tires, and running diagnostics on a consistent basis can mean the difference between an efficient fleet and a costly breakdown.
